The MSc in Accounting and Finance OTHM qualification is a postgraduate degree that aims to equip students with advanced knowledge and skills in accounting and finance, preparing them for senior roles in industry.
Learning outcomes of the MSc in Accounting and Finance OTHM qualification include developing a deep understanding of financial management, accounting principles, and financial analysis, as well as the ability to apply theoretical knowledge to real-world scenarios.
The duration of the MSc in Accounting and Finance OTHM qualification is typically 12 months full-time, with students completing a series of modules that cover topics such as financial management, financial analysis, and accounting for business.
The MSc in Accounting and Finance OTHM qualification is highly relevant to the accounting and finance industry, with graduates going on to work in senior roles such as financial manager, accountant, or financial analyst.
Industry relevance is also high, with the qualification aligning with the requirements of the Chartered Institute of Management Accountants (CIMA) and the Association of Chartered Certified Accountants (ACCA).
